What is the difference between close and cloze reading?

What is the difference between close and cloze reading?

is that close is an end or conclusion or close can be an enclosed field while cloze is (education) a form of written examination technique in which candidates are required to provide words that have been omitted from sentences, thereby demonstrating their knowledge and comprehension of the text.

What is a cloze phrase?

Cloze statements, cloze procedures, or sentence completion tasks are word retrieval tasks that require the participant (child, student, client, etc.) to fill in the blank. The adult says part of the sentence or phrase or verse but intentionally deletes a word, enticing the child to complete it with the correct one.

How is the Cloze test scored?

It works as follows:

  1. Replace every Nth word in the text with blanks.
  2. Ask your test participants to read the modified text and fill in the blanks with their best guesses as to the missing words.
  3. The score is the percentage of correctly guessed words.

What are cloze sentences?

Cloze sentences are sentences in which key words are deleted, covered up or blocked out. When presented with cloze sentences, students must use context clues to determine the missing word. Cloze sentences are also an engaging way to reinforce content-specific vocabulary and academic language.

What is the process of close reading?

Close reading is thoughtful, critical analysis of a text that focuses on significant details or patterns in order to develop a deep, precise understanding of the text’s form, craft, meanings, etc. It is a key requirement of the Common Core State Standards and directs the reader’s attention to the text itself.

What do cloze passages assess?

Definition: A cloze passage is a reading comprehension exercise in which words have been omitted in a systematic fashion. Cloze exercises assess comprehension and background knowledge, and they are also excellent indicators of whether the reading level and language level of the text are appropriate for a given student.

What is the Cloze reading strategy?

Cloze procedure is a technique in which words are deleted from a passage according to a word-count formula or various other criteria. The passage is presented to students, who insert words as they read to complete and construct meaning from the text.

What does a cloze test measure?

Summary: Cloze Tests provide empirical evidence of how easy a text is to read and understand for a specified target audience. They thus measure reading comprehension, and not just a readability score.

What is a cloze exercise example?

A cloze is a practice exercise where learners have to replace words missing from a text. These are removed at regular intervals, for example every five words. Clozes are often used to practise reading skills or as a general language review. They are common in testing.
